> There is an informal contract between the cpu_init() functions and
> riscv_cpu_realize(): if cpu->env.misa_ext is zero, assume that the
> default settings were loaded via register_cpu_props() and do validations
> to set env.misa_ext.  If it's not zero, skip this whole process and
> assume that the board somehow did everything.
>
> At this moment, all SiFive CPUs are setting a non-zero misa_ext during
> their cpu_init() and skipping a good chunk of riscv_cpu_realize().
> This causes problems when the code being skipped in riscv_cpu_realize()
> contains fixes or assumptions that affects all CPUs, meaning that SiFive
> CPUs are missing out.
>
> To allow this code to not be skipped anymore, all the cpu->cfg.ext_* 
> attributes
> needs to be set during cpu_init() time. At this moment this is being done in
> register_cpu_props(). The SiFive oards are setting their own extensions during

The SiFive boards

> cpu_init() though, meaning that they don't want all the defaults from
> register_cpu_props().
>
> Let's move the contract between *_cpu_init() and riscv_cpu_realize() to
> register_cpu_props(). Inside this function we'll check if cpu->env.misa_ext
> was set and, if that's the case, set all relevant cpu->cfg.ext_*
> attributes, and only that. Leave the 'misa_ext' = 0 case as is today,
> i.e. loading all the defaults from riscv_cpu_extensions[].
>
> register_cpu_props() can then be called by all the cpu_init() functions,
> including the SiFive ones. This will make all CPUs behave more in line
> with that riscv_cpu_realize() expects.
